Alex Ndubai, CEO of VALR Capital, detailed his company's market focus in a recent interview with CB Insights. VALR Capital positions itself as a credit risk infrastructure provider for institutional lenders across sub-Saharan Africa.
The firm serves banks, microfinance institutions, impact funds, and debt funds. Ndubai stated that the collective lending volume through these institutions, excluding South Africa, amounts to approximately $345 billion. VALR Capital monetizes a portion of this volume through fees, typically between 1% and 2% of the book value on its current contracts.
While SME portfolios represent the company's entry point, its platform is capable of monitoring any loan book.
